Summary

Part of a series, which looks at different forms of transport from a global perspective and gives the reader an understanding of different cultures as well as introducing technology that plays a vital role in our lives. This book about trains also includes a timeline to show the history of transport.

Trains by Chris Oxlade

How do maglev trains work? What makes mountain railroad tracks different? Why do express trains have a special shape? This book looks at types of trains that are used for carrying cargo and passengers. Many trains in busy cities run underground. Shuttle trains carry cars and buses through tunnels. Special luxury trains provide beds and meals for their passengers.
